VS Gaitonde was an influential Indian abstract painter known for his non-representational art that emphasized color, form, and texture. His work is characterized by a deep spiritual quality, often reflecting themes of silence and introspection. Gaitonde's paintings are celebrated for their meditative and contemplative nature, making him a pivotal figure in Indian modernism.
VS Gaitonde's Midjourney style representation captures the essence of his abstract and minimalist approach. The artwork features geometric and rectilinear forms with a focus on balance and symmetry. The color palette consists of earthy tones, including muted yellows and deep reds, creating a tranquil and introspective atmosphere. Fine brushwork and textured surfaces add depth, while the subtle gradations and soft edges contribute to a sense of spatial depth and contemplation. This style embodies the spiritual and philosophical themes present in Gaitonde's work, resonating with Indian modernism and abstract expressionism.
